Division two of the maiden is just as competitive and, with Sir Michael Stoute's yard having come into some form recently, his stoutly-bred colt Glittering Gold must be taken seriously on his debut for Her Majesty. Circus Mondao went close in two maidens as a two-year-old and is another for the shortlist, but SPOKE TO CARLO gets the vote now dropping back into maiden company. He wasn't disgraced behind Cavaleiro and Harvard N Yale in a conditions event at Newbury and hinted that a step up in trip would bring about more improvement. Moshaagib and Bayan are others to note.
